Patchy or Discolored Areas:

One of the primary signs that your lawn may need professional fertilization is the presence of patchy or discolored areas. These areas often appear thin, sparse, or exhibit a different color compared to the rest of the lawn. Such symptoms can indicate underlying nutrient deficiencies or soil imbalances, highlighting the importance of targeted fertilization treatments provided by professionals like Turf 10.

Weed Infestations:

The presence of weed infestations can also signal the need for professional fertilization services before summer. Weeds compete with grass for nutrients and space, indicating potential issues with soil health or nutrient levels. Addressing these issues through professional fertilization not only targets weeds at their root cause but also promotes healthy grass growth to naturally outcompete weeds.

Slow or Stunted Growth:

If you notice that your lawn is experiencing slow or stunted growth, it may be a clear indicator that professional fertilization is needed before summer arrives. Poor soil quality or nutrient deficiencies can hinder grass growth, resulting in a lackluster and unappealing lawn. By assessing your lawn’s nutrient levels and implementing a customized fertilization plan, professionals like Turf 10 can stimulate healthy growth and restore vitality to your turf.

Thinning or Bare Spots:

Thinning or bare spots in your lawn are another telltale sign that professional fertilization services are necessary before summer. These areas often indicate soil compaction, nutrient deficiencies, or other underlying issues that require attention. With targeted fertilization treatments, professionals can address these problems effectively, encouraging robust grass growth and filling in bare patches for a lush and uniform lawn.
